25m wet shotcrete available for water conservancy and hydropower construction

Below are its features and advantages tailored to such projects:

 


Key Features:

Robotic Arm with 25m Reach:

The 25-meter robotic arm allows for precise application over large areas, including steep slopes and tall walls, without frequent repositioning.

Wet Shotcrete Technology:

Wet shotcrete involves pumping pre-mixed concrete through a hose and pneumatically spraying it onto surfaces. This ensures better consistency, reduced rebound (waste material), and higher-quality finishes compared to dry shotcrete.

High Pumping Capacity:

Designed to handle large volumes of wet concrete with high delivery pressures, ensuring smooth and continuous application for large-scale projects.

Durability in Harsh Conditions:

Engineered to work in demanding environments, such as humid, high-pressure, or water-rich areas typical in hydropower and water conservancy sites.

Articulating Boom:

Offers multi-directional flexibility, making it easy to cover hard-to-reach areas like curved tunnel walls, spillway slopes, or dam faces.

Anti-Corrosion Design:

Built with materials resistant to moisture, chemicals, and abrasives to ensure longevity when working in water-dense environments.

 


Advantages for Hydropower and Water Conservancy:

Enhanced Efficiency:

Wet shotcrete eliminates the need for on-site concrete mixing, reducing time and labor.

High Bond Strength:

Wet shotcrete adheres well to surfaces, making it ideal for stabilizing slopes, lining tunnels, or repairing concrete structures.

Minimized Rebound:

Reduced material waste and cleanup, saving costs in large-scale projects.

Adaptable to Complex Geometries:

The robotic arm can accurately spray on irregular surfaces, such as curved spillways or tunnel cross-sections.

Environmentally Friendly:

Wet shotcrete produces less dust compared to dry shotcrete, improving air quality on-site, particularly in confined spaces like tunnels.

Safe for Workers:

By automating concrete spraying, workers can operate the machine remotely, reducing exposure to hazardous areas.

 


Applications in Water Conservancy and Hydropower:

Slope Stabilization:

Spray concrete on embankments and slopes to prevent erosion and enhance stability.

Dam Repairs and Construction:

Reinforce or build dam structures using wet shotcrete, ensuring durability in water-saturated environments.

Tunnel Linings:

Create strong, uniform linings in tunnels used for water conveyance or power generation.

Spillways and Reservoirs:

Form durable, water-resistant coatings for spillways and reservoir walls.
